Alan Shearer has won several trophies during his illustrious football career. One of the notable achievements in his career was winning the Premier League title with Blackburn Rovers in the 1994–95 season. Shearer played a crucial role in Blackburn’s success that season, contributing with his goal-scoring prowess.

In addition to the Premier League title, Shearer also won individual accolades, including two consecutive Premier League Golden Boots during his time at Blackburn Rovers. These awards recognized him as the league’s top goal-scorer in the respective seasons.

While at Newcastle United, his hometown club, Shearer led the team to the FA Cup finals in 1998 and 1999, although they were runners-up on both occasions. Despite not securing FA Cup victories, these achievements underline his impact on Newcastle United and his ability to guide the team to competitive heights.

How Many Times Did Alan Shearer Captain England?

Alan Shearer captained the England national football team on numerous occasions. He served as the captain of the national team during the latter part of his international career. Shearer was appointed as the captain by then-England manager Glenn Hoddle in 1996.
